Accessing the Screen Recording Tool

  • πŸ’‘ To begin recording your screen on a TOSHIBA Dynabook Tecra, locate the Print Screen button on your keyboard, typically found next to the F12 key.
  • πŸ“Œ Alternatively, you can use the key combination Windows + Shift + S simultaneously.
  • βœ… In Windows 11, pressing the Print Screen button alone is sufficient to activate the screen recording tool.

Selecting and Starting the Recording

  • 🎯 After activating the tool, you can select the specific portion of the screen you wish to record, or choose to record the entire screen.
  • πŸŽ™οΈ You have the option to enable or disable your microphone to include voice narration in your recording.
  • πŸ”Š You can also mute or unmute system audio as needed.
  • πŸš€ Once your selections are made, click Start to begin the countdown and commence recording.

During and After Recording

  • 🎬 While recording, you can perform any actions on your screen and speak if the microphone is enabled.
  • ⏸️ The recording can be paused and resumed later if necessary.
  • ⏹️ To finish, click Stop.
  • πŸ“‚ The recording will be automatically saved to the 'Screen Recordings' folder, located within the 'Videos' folder in File Explorer.
  • βœ‚οΈ You can use the trim button to edit the recorded video.
